HTML Dersleri

HTML Karakter Kodları (Entity Codes)

eminbasbayan

eminbasbayan

3 dk okuma
HTML Karakter Kodları (Entity Codes)
🔍 Büyütmek için tıklayın

HTML yazarken bazen klavyemizden kolayca yazamayacağımız özel karakterlere veya HTML’nin kendisi tarafından ayrılmış karakterlere ihtiyaç duyarız. Bu gibi durumlarda HTML Entities (varlık kodları) devreye girer. Bu yazıda, HTML Entities’in ne olduğu, nasıl çalıştığı ve örnek kullanımları açıklanacaktır.

HTML Entities Nedir?

  • HTML Entities, HTML belgesi içinde özel karakterleri göstermek için kullanılan özel kodlardır.
  • Neden Gerekli?
    • Bazı karakterler, HTML tarafından ayrılmıştır (örneğin < ve > etiketlerde kullanılır).
    • Klavyede kolayca yazılamayan semboller (örneğin, ©, ) için kullanılır.

HTML Entity Söz Dizimi

  • Her HTML Entity şu şekilde yazılır:
    • Başında bir & (ampersand),
    • Ardından karakterin adı veya kodu,
    • Sonunda bir ; (noktalı virgül) bulunur.

Örneğin:

  • < karakterini göstermek için: &lt;
  • > karakterini göstermek için: &gt;
  • © sembolü için: &copy;

Sık Kullanılan HTML Entities

KarakterEntity KoduEntity İsmiSonuç
<&#60;&lt;<
>&#62;&gt;>
&&#38;&amp;&
©&#169;&copy;©
®&#174;&reg;®
"&#34;&quot;"
'&#39;&apos;'
&#8594;&rarr;

HTML Entities Kullanımı

1. Ayrılmış Karakterler

HTML’de <, >, ve & gibi karakterler özel bir anlam taşır. Bu nedenle, bu karakterleri metin içinde göstermek için entity kullanmanız gerekir:

<p>1 &lt; 2 &amp; 2 &gt; 1</p>

Sonuç:

1 < 2 & 2 > 1

2. Özel Semboller

Kopyalama hakkı, ticari marka veya diğer semboller için:

<p>Tüm hakları saklıdır &copy; 2025. Ticari marka &reg; sembolü.</p>

Sonuç:

Tüm hakları saklıdır © 2025. Ticari marka ® sembolü.

HTML Entities ile Sayı Kodu Kullanımı

Her HTML Entity’nin bir isimli kodu olduğu gibi bir de sayı kodu vardır. Sayı kodu genellikle şu şekilde yazılır:

  • &#kod;

Örneğin:

  • &lt; yerine &#60; yazabilirsiniz.
<p>Sayı kodu kullanımı: &#60; &#62; &#38;</p>

Sonuç:

Sayı kodu kullanımı: < > &

Sık Kullanılan Senaryolar

1. Matematiksel İfadeler

<p>Matematiksel semboller: ≤ &le;, ≥ &ge;</p>

Sonuç:

Matematiksel semboller: ≤, ≥

2. Şiir veya Özel Formatlar

Satır sonu gerektiren şiirler için br etiketiyle birlikte kullanabilirsiniz:

<p> Göklerde kartallar süzülür<br> Ufuklar sonsuz bir yol<br> &hearts; ve &spades; gibi semboller<br> </p>

Örnek Proje

<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>HTML Entities Örnekleri</title> </head> <body> <h1>HTML Entities Örnekleri</h1> <p>Ayrılmış karakterler: &lt;, &gt;, &amp;</p> <p>Özel semboller: &copy;, &reg;, &hearts;, &rarr;</p> <p>Matematiksel ifadeler: 5 &lt; 6 &amp; 6 &gt; 5</p> <p>Kart sembolleri: &spades;, &hearts;, &diams;, &clubs;</p> <p>Unicode karakterleri: &#9824;, &#9829;, &#9830;, &#9827;</p> </body> </html>

Sonuç:

  • Ayrılmış karakterler, özel semboller ve matematiksel ifadeler düzgün bir şekilde gösterilir.

Sonuç

HTML Entities, özel karakterleri ve sembolleri kolayca göstermenizi sağlar. Bu kodları öğrenerek web sitelerinizde daha zengin içerikler oluşturabilirsiniz. Özel semboller veya ayrılmış karakterlere ihtiyaç duyduğunuzda, &entity; formatını kullanmayı unutmayın!

Etiketler

#Eğitimler#HTML Dersleri

İlgili Yazılar

Bu konuyla ilgili diğer yazılarımızı da inceleyebilirsiniz

HTML: Web Sayfalarının Temel Yapı Taşı
Genel

HTML: Web Sayfalarının Temel Yapı Taşı

HTML (HyperText Markup Language), bir web sayfasının temel yapı taşını oluşturan ve içeriğin yapısını belirleyen bir işaretleme dilidir. Web geliştirme dünyasında, HTML, bir web sayfasındaki her şeyin "ne" olduğunu tanımlamak için kullanılır. Örneğin, bu bir

3 dk
HTML'de Paragraf Etiketi (P Tag)
Genel

HTML'de Paragraf Etiketi (P Tag)

HTML, web sayfalarının temel yapı taşlarını oluşturan birçok öğeye sahiptir. Bu öğelerden biri de **paragraf etiketi** ya da yaygın bilinen adıyla **P tag**'dir. Paragraf etiketi, genellikle bir metin paragrafını ifade etmek için ku

3 dk
HTML Başlık Etiketleri (H1-H6)
Genel

HTML Başlık Etiketleri (H1-H6)

HTML'de başlık etiketleri, bir web sayfasının içeriğini hiyerarşik bir şekilde düzenlemek ve anlamlı bir yapı kazandırmak için kullanılır. Bu etiketler, **H1**'den **H6**'ya kadar sıralanır ve her biri farklı bir ö

3 dk
HTML İskeleti ve Boilerplate
Genel

HTML İskeleti ve Boilerplate

HTML belgeleri oluştururken, her sayfanın doğru ve geçerli bir yapı kullanması gereklidir. Şimdiye kadar yazılmış HTML kodları genellikle geçici olarak çalışsa da, **HTML iskeleti** olmadan bir belge teknik olarak geçersizdir. Bu yazıda, HTML'in

3 dk
HTML’de Listeler: Ordered List (OL) ve Unordered List (UL)
Genel

HTML’de Listeler: Ordered List (OL) ve Unordered List (UL)

HTML, web sayfalarındaki bilgileri düzenli ve anlaşılır bir şekilde sunmak için listeleme özellikleri sunar. **Ordered List (OL)** ve **Unordered List (UL)**, HTML’de kullanılan iki ana liste türüdür. Bu yazıda, bu liste türlerinin

3 dk
HTML Anchor (Bağlantı) Etiketi
Genel

HTML Anchor (Bağlantı) Etiketi

Web sayfalarının temel yapı taşlarından biri olan **anchor (a)** etiketi, bağlantı oluşturmak için kullanılır. Bu etiket, başka bir web sayfasına, bir e-posta adresine, bir dosyaya veya aynı sayfanın bir bölümüne bağlantı kurmanızı sağlar. Bu yazıda, anchor etike

3 dk